Role: Mail Order and Warehouse Assistant
Salary: £12.60 per hour
Hours: Zero-hours
Location: American Express Stadium, Brighton BN1 9BL
Contract Type: Casual, hourly paid
Deadline Day: 20th March 2025
About Brighton & Hove Albion FC
We compete at the highest levels of football on a global stage while embracing our Sussex community spirit. At the heart of everything we do is our commitment to high performance, professional excellence, and making a positive impact.
Help us deliver a fast, reliable service for every fan.
We're on the hunt for enthusiastic Mail Order & Warehouse Assistants to power our high-energy retail operation. You'll be at the heart of the action – picking, packing, and dispatching online orders with precision and care. You'll also handle customer inquiries, keep our stock in check, and even get hands-on experience in shirt printing for online orders.
About you
If you’ve got warehouse experience and a knack for stock control and EPOS systems, you’re already ahead of the game! You’ll thrive in a fast-paced environment and stay cool under pressure whilst being accurate and efficient because getting our fans’ orders right and on time is what we do best. With strong communication skills and a commitment to exceptional customer service, you’ll ensure every fan gets the five-star experience they deserve.
